OEM Grade Engine Splash Shield Under Cover Compatible with 2008-2013 BMW M3 4.0L V8 Front Plastic OEM 51757899820-PFM Under Engine Undercarriage Protection Road Debris Shield Direct Fit from other stores

Items per page